If you are adventurous, you can take the radio out yourself. The panel around the radio pops right off. Then use a 10mm socket to take the bolts out. Make sure you unplug all the harnesses.
For the radio, you may have to loosen a few Philips screws, before prying the top cover off. You should be able to somehow lift and slide the CDs out.
As for fixing the problem, it's hard to determine which part(s) may be bad, so it's probably not worth spending the time and money to do so.
